在应用程序首次调用ShowWindow时showwindow,应当使用WinMain函数showwindow的nCmdshow参数然而,后续调用时,必须采用预先定义的特定值,而非WinMain函数初始提供的值,以确保正确显示窗口当应用程序由启动信息在STARTUPINFO结构中设置显示模式时,第一次ShowWindow调用中nCmdShow参数将被忽略这时,ShowWindow会依据启动信息来。
意思就是,这个当前的表单,你准备在哪里显示它有三个选项1在屏幕中 就是在计算机显示器上单独显示这个表单2在顶层表单中 就是作为顶层表单的子表单,在顶层表单中显示何为顶层表单呢,见下面 3作为顶层表单 就是指定,当前这个表单为顶层表单是的 一般有。
这个是隐藏当前窗口吧如果是隐藏当前窗口的话不用专门又另外定义一个CWnd对像来操作的,可以直接这样thisShowWindowSW_HIDE,或者this都可以省略 CWnd。
你直接写ShowWindow表示是主窗口显示, 即 thisShowWindowSW_SHOW要应用到IDD_MY10_DIALOG窗口上, 应该这样写GetDlgItemIDD_MY10_DIALOGShowWindowSW_RESTORE。
首先定义一个句柄组,用于存储子窗口句柄在按钮被单击时,调用枚举子窗口函数,将子窗口句柄加入句柄组然后编写枚举过程,将子窗口句柄加入句柄组,并递归调用自身,继续枚举子窗口在枚举过程完成后,遍历句柄组,使用ShowWindow函数显示所有子窗口ShowWindow函数的第二个参数为1,表示显示窗口以下是。
意思是当m_dlg的句柄为空时创建m_dlg这个对话框第一中情况,ShowWindow放在外面一定为执行ShowWindow 第二种情况,只有m_dlg的句柄为空时才会执行ShowWindow 倘若m_dlg创建后某个地方将其隐藏起来showwindow了第一种情况会将对话框显示出来,第二种情况不会,因为此时m_dlg已经创建不会进到if 语句中SW。
ShowWindowHWND hwnd,int nCmdShow 第一个是你窗体的句柄,第二个是显示模式,你可以先判断hwnd 是否NULL,nCmdShow 可以设置0,1,2,3,4,5,6等 发。
上一篇: Fast网络速度测试工具,fast internet speed test
下一篇: 17gan,17干活违法吗
联系电话:18300931024
在线QQ客服:616139763
官方微信:18300931024
官方邮箱: 616139763@qq.com